Overview of Boom Lift Types

Boom lifts fall into three primary categories. Telescopic boom lifts feature straight, extendable arms for maximum reach and height. They excel in open areas where direct access is essential.

Articulating boom lifts offer multiple jointed sections for navigating around obstacles. This flexibility makes them ideal for complex environments with overhead limitations.

Towable models provide compact, trailer-mounted convenience. These units handle smaller tasks efficiently while offering easy mobility between locations.

Proper Loading and Securing Techniques for Flatbed Transport

Executing a successful equipment move requires precision during the loading and securing phases. We focus on meticulous procedures that guarantee stability and security throughout the journey.

Using Ramps and Tie-Downs Effectively

We begin by positioning the trailer on completely level ground. This foundational step prevents dangerous shifts during the loading process.

Our team uses only properly rated ramps designed to handle the specific weight of your machinery. A dedicated spotter guides the operator, ensuring safe alignment and preventing damage.

Once positioned, we secure the machine with heavy-duty chains or straps. These are always rated for the equipment’s total weight.

Following Manufacturer Guidelines and Load Limits

Adherence to manufacturer specifications is non-negotiable. We connect tie-downs only to designated anchor points on the machine’s frame.

Equal tension across all four corners creates a balanced system. This prevents any movement during transit.

Proper weight distribution on the trailer is critical. We align the machinery’s center of gravity with the trailer’s axles for optimal vehicle handling.

Our final checks are thorough. We verify the machine is powered off, the parking brake is engaged, and all connections are secure.

Compliance with DOT regulations is essential. For oversized loads, we secure all necessary permits in advance. This careful approach prevents delays and ensures a safe arrival.

Operating Controls: Ground Versus Basket for Boom Lifts

Mastering the control systems of an aerial work platform is a fundamental skill for safe transport preparation. We prioritize operator training on both ground-level and platform-based systems.

This knowledge ensures precise maneuvering during critical loading phases.

Comparing Control Panels and Safety Features

Operation begins at the ground-level panel. A key selects the active control station—purple for ground, light blue for the platform.

Pulling the red emergency stop button readies the machine. The ground panel features intuitive switches for all major functions.

These controls manage the platform height, boom extension, and basket tilt. This setup allows one person to position the machine safely onto a trailer.

When you need to operate from the platform, safety protocols intensify. The operator must be properly harnessed before activating the system.

A yellow crush guard protection cord serves as a vital emergency feature. Contact with overhead objects disconnects this wire, triggering an immediate shutdown.

Ignition requires holding down a foot pedal, which differs from ground controls. This design prevents accidental operation.

Critical information is always visible. A legend details all safety features. A load capacity chart shows maximum weight limits at various extensions.

We never exceed these specifications. Safety is non-negotiable when handling such powerful equipment.

Adapting to Uneven or Sloped Ground

Uneven terrain requires specialized techniques for safe equipment relocation. Soft ground, slopes, and unstable surfaces present significant risks. We assess soil conditions and make necessary adjustments.

On sloped surfaces, we position the counterweight uphill for maximum stability. The boom remains in its lowest possible position during movement. This approach minimizes tipping hazards.

Different surfaces like gravel, mud, or grass affect machine stability differently. Our team understands these variations and adjusts techniques accordingly. Safety remains our primary concern in all conditions.

Can I transport a boom lift with the boom extended?

Never. We always retract the boom fully and lower the platform before transport. This minimizes height and maintains a low center of gravity for safety.
